Federal government to turn a Kentucky uranium plant into an AI data center and gas power complex
PADUCAH, Ky. (AP) — The U.S. Department of Energy is harnessing the artificial intelligence boom in its bid to convert another Cold War-era uranium enrichment site, tapping private equity to fund a $100 billion data center complex that will include its own new natural gas and battery storage power plant in Kentucky.
